The MERI Group of Institutions, Janakpuri, organized a press conference at the Press Club today. Senior representatives from the institution provided an overview of the MERI Center for International Studies (CIS), the MERI Start-Up Hub, and the academic programs offered across its colleges.
Opening the event, Prof. Lalit Aggarwal, Vice President of the MERI Group, emphasized the institution’s legacy of over three decades in education. He stated: “MERI Group of Institutions has been a significant player in providing quality education, offering UGC-recognized courses affiliated with IP University, Delhi, and MDU, Rohtak.”
Discussing the MERI Center for International Studies (CIS), Prof. Aggarwal explained its mission to establish cultural and intellectual connections with nations worldwide. He added: “CIS fosters mutual exchange of modern education and cultural heritage, enabling students to understand and engage with global perspectives.”
Empowering Entrepreneurs through the MERI Start-Up Hub
Prof. Aggarwal highlighted the MERI Start-Up Hub’s focus on equipping students with entrepreneurial skills, saying: “Our aim is to empower students to become self-reliant and create employment opportunities for others. By integrating research and innovation, the hub nurtures new ideas, enabling students to operate on a global platform.”
Insights on CIS and Start-Up Hub
Prof. (Dr.) Ramakant Dwivedi, Head of CIS, elaborated on its unique positioning, stating: “Such centers have traditionally been part of government institutions, but MERI Group has pioneered this initiative to encourage discussions on global geopolitical issues and enhance students’ awareness of international affairs.”
Mr. Luv Aggarwal, Head of the Start-Up Hub, added: “The hub motivates youth to tackle challenges associated with start-ups while fostering creative thinking and self-confidence. Our goal is to prepare them to face global challenges with ease and contribute to the economy by creating job opportunities.”
